Yellow/green/blue/red quilt top
My sister asked me to make a quilt for a ladies' retreat at a camp in NC. This will be used as a door prize.
She originally asked me to try to make it like a picture I had which showed reproduction fabrics (I'm assuming 30's), of which I have none. I pulled fabrics in these colors and this is what I ended up with. It is a lot brighter than I originally envisioned, but in the end, the top turned out pretty.
It's quite different from what I've been doing and is really simple--just 5" squares, 1.5" white sashings and cornerstones--all on point. Queen size - 92x98". Although simple, I'm finding that anything "on point" is harder than not on point.
